myVip.wxml 3.8 KB
<view class="employee_control data-v-7edaf220"><view class="employeeList data-v-7edaf220"><view class="header data-v-7edaf220"><view class="list_card data-v-7edaf220"><text class="data-v-7edaf220">时间</text><text class="data-v-7edaf220">价格</text><text class="data-v-7edaf220">状态</text><text class="data-v-7edaf220">设置</text></view></view><view class="list data-v-7edaf220"><block wx:for="{{vipList}}" wx:for-item="item" wx:for-index="index" wx:key="index"><view class="list_card data-v-7edaf220"><text class="flex-box data-v-7edaf220">{{item.time}}</text><text class="flex-box data-v-7edaf220">{{"¥"+item.price}}</text><text class="flex-box data-v-7edaf220" style="{{'color:'+(item.status===1?'#1784FC':'#FC1717')+';'}}">{{item.status===1?'正常':'下架'}}</text><u-icon vue-id="{{'5569d5e6-1-'+index}}" name="setting" size="16" color="#333" data-event-opts="{{[['^click',[['editEmployee',['$0'],[[['vipList','',index]]]]]]]}}" bind:click="__e" class="data-v-7edaf220" bind:__l="__l"></u-icon></view></block></view></view><view data-event-opts="{{[['tap',[['addEmployee',['$event']]]]]}}" class="add_vipCard data-v-7edaf220" bindtap="__e"><u-icon vue-id="5569d5e6-2" name="plus-circle" class="data-v-7edaf220" bind:__l="__l"></u-icon><text class="m-l-20 data-v-7edaf220">添加会员卡</text></view><u-popup vue-id="5569d5e6-3" show="{{show}}" mode="center" round="{{12}}" data-event-opts="{{[['^close',[['e0']]]]}}" bind:close="__e" class="data-v-7edaf220" bind:__l="__l" vue-slots="{{['default']}}"><view class="employeeForm data-v-7edaf220"><u--form vue-id="{{('5569d5e6-4')+','+('5569d5e6-3')}}" model="{{form}}" labelWidth="60" data-ref="uForm" class="data-v-7edaf220 vue-ref" bind:__l="__l" vue-slots="{{['default']}}"><u-form-item vue-id="{{('5569d5e6-5')+','+('5569d5e6-4')}}" label="时间" prop="time" class="data-v-7edaf220" bind:__l="__l" vue-slots="{{['default']}}"><u-input bind:input="__e" vue-id="{{('5569d5e6-6')+','+('5569d5e6-5')}}" border="bottom" placeholder="请填写天数" value="{{form.time}}" data-event-opts="{{[['^input',[['__set_model',['$0','time','$event',[]],['form']]]]]}}" class="data-v-7edaf220" bind:__l="__l"></u-input></u-form-item><u-form-item vue-id="{{('5569d5e6-7')+','+('5569d5e6-4')}}" label="价格" prop="price" class="data-v-7edaf220" bind:__l="__l" vue-slots="{{['default']}}"><u-input bind:input="__e" vue-id="{{('5569d5e6-8')+','+('5569d5e6-7')}}" border="bottom" placeholder="请填写价格" suffixIcon="rmb" suffixIconStyle="color: #333" value="{{form.price}}" data-event-opts="{{[['^input',[['__set_model',['$0','price','$event',[]],['form']]]]]}}" class="data-v-7edaf220" bind:__l="__l"></u-input></u-form-item><u-form-item vue-id="{{('5569d5e6-9')+','+('5569d5e6-4')}}" label="状态" prop="status" class="data-v-7edaf220" bind:__l="__l" vue-slots="{{['default']}}"><u-switch bind:input="__e" vue-id="{{('5569d5e6-10')+','+('5569d5e6-9')}}" activeValue="{{1}}" inactiveValue="{{0}}" activeColor="#1784FC" inactiveColor="#FC1717" value="{{form.status}}" data-event-opts="{{[['^input',[['__set_model',['$0','status','$event',[]],['form']]]]]}}" class="data-v-7edaf220" bind:__l="__l"></u-switch></u-form-item><u-form-item vue-id="{{('5569d5e6-11')+','+('5569d5e6-4')}}" class="data-v-7edaf220" bind:__l="__l" vue-slots="{{['default']}}"><view class="btn data-v-7edaf220"><u-button vue-id="{{('5569d5e6-12')+','+('5569d5e6-11')}}" text="提交" color="linear-gradient( 270deg, #FFA100 0%, #FCD723 100%);" shape="circle" data-event-opts="{{[['^click',[['e1']]]]}}" bind:click="__e" class="data-v-7edaf220" bind:__l="__l"></u-button><u-button vue-id="{{('5569d5e6-13')+','+('5569d5e6-11')}}" text="取消" color="#DDD" shape="circle" data-event-opts="{{[['^click',[['e2']]]]}}" bind:click="__e" class="data-v-7edaf220" bind:__l="__l"></u-button></view></u-form-item></u--form></view></u-popup></view>